    If \[\sum\nolimits_{i=1}^{9}{({{x}_{i}}-5)=9}\] and \[\sum\nolimits_{i=1}^{9}{{{({{x}_{i}}-5)}^{2}}=45,}\] then the standard deviation of the 9 items \[{{x}_{1}},{{x}_{2}},...{{x}_{9}}\] is

    A) 9

    B) 4

    C) 3

    D) 2

    Correct Answer: D

    Solution :

    [d] Let \[\sum\limits_{i=1}^{9}{({{x}_{i}}-5)}=9\Rightarrow \sum\limits_{i=1}^{9}{{{x}_{i}}-\sum\limits_{i=1}^{9}{5=9}}\] \[\Rightarrow \sum\limits_{i=1}^{9}{{{x}_{i}}-(9\times 5)=9;}\] \[\sum{{{x}_{i}}-45=\Rightarrow \sum{{{x}_{i}}=54}}\] Similarly, \[\sum{x_{i}^{2}-10\times 54+25\times 9=45\Rightarrow \sum{x_{i}^{2}=360}}\] \[\Rightarrow \sigma =\sqrt{\frac{360}{9}-{{\left( \frac{54}{9} \right)}^{2}}}=\sqrt{\frac{324}{81}}=2\]
